looney tunes marathon- on the weekend they showed looney toons all day saturday and sunday You are referring to "June Bugs", which they did from 1993-2002. In 2003, it moved to Boomerang. You'd catch that every year on the first Saturday/Sunday in June.

They did the 24 hour Iron Giant marathon to coincide with The Powerpuff Movie premiere. All the commercials were trailers and promos for the movie.
